Taiwan landslide's hidden motion comes into focus as fiber optics track deep slip
Source ↗ 👁 0 💬 0
Placed within a borehole drilled deep through the layers of a landslide, a fiber optic cable captured tiny, periodic stick-slip events that offer a unique glimpse at the complex movements within the landslide's shear zone.
